SIP Trunking
SIP trunking is a crucial feature of wholesale VoIP services, allowing businesses to make voice calls over the internet by connecting their existing phone systems to the cloud. This technology not only reduces costs but also enhances the scalability of communication systems, making it adaptable to varying business needs.
SIP trunking operates by utilizing the Session Initiation Protocol to establish voice sessions between end-users over the internet. This method streamlines communication by eliminating the need for traditional phone lines, which can be costly and inflexible. By leveraging VoIP technology, organizations benefit from significant cost savings, especially during high-volume calling periods. SIP trunking supports advanced features such as video conferencing, unified messaging, and enhanced call management, ultimately elevating the customer experience.
To successfully implement this technology, businesses should consider several technical requirements, including a reliable internet connection, compatible IP-based phone systems, and robust security measures to protect sensitive communications. The transition to SIP trunking not only revitalizes communication strategies but also fosters collaboration among teams, driving productivity and satisfaction.

Setting Up Infrastructure
Setting up the infrastructure for wholesale VoIP services involves ensuring that the necessary network requirements and equipment are in place to support seamless communication. This includes assessing bandwidth needs, selecting compatible hardware, and configuring routers and switches to optimize call quality and reliability.
To start, the first step should be a comprehensive network assessment to determine current and future bandwidth requirements based on user demand. Implementing quality of service (QoS) measures can help prioritize VoIP traffic, thus enhancing the audio experience during calls.
- Hardware selection: Choose IP phones, gateways, and session border controllers that meet your specific needs while checking compatibility with existing systems.
- Software installation: Utilize a robust VoIP platform, ensuring that it supports features like SIP and has a user-friendly interface for management.
- Network configuration: Correctly configure firewalls and NAT settings to allow VoIP traffic through securely.
- Testing: Conduct thorough testing of call quality, latency, and jitter to identify any issues before full deployment.
In case of troubleshooting, common issues include poor call quality or connectivity problems. Regularly check for updates on firmware and network settings, and consider enabling your team with troubleshooting guides to address these challenges swiftly.

Testing and Maintenance
Regular testing and maintenance are crucial to ensuring the reliability and performance of wholesale VoIP services, allowing businesses to identify and address any potential issues before they impact operations. This involves routine system checks, performance monitoring, and updates to software and hardware as needed.
To maintain optimal performance, it is essential for organizations to adopt a proactive approach. First, they should establish a comprehensive performance monitoring system that actively tracks call quality, latency, and packet loss. These metrics are vital in ensuring a seamless communication experience. Implementing a structured maintenance schedule can significantly minimize downtime.
- Conduct regular system audits to evaluate both hardware and software performance.
- Utilize automated tools for real-time monitoring to quickly identify and resolve issues.
- Establish clear communication channels with VoIP providers for prompt support when necessary.
By taking these steps, businesses can not only maintain their VoIP systems effectively but also enhance overall operational efficiency.
